Output 240520fbad74b32a7497c21eced6d781e6851f66565881823e40cefbb608289e:1

value
7477920
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f436dd642997a3292f8ce033f2ebec660f98fa5c913980373be4e6122a61753
address
bc1phapkm4jzn9ar9yhcecpn7t47ces0nra9eyfesqmnhe8xzg4xzafs6hwes3
transaction
240520fbad74b32a7497c21eced6d781e6851f66565881823e40cefbb608289e
spent
true